Name 10 unique homophones
kondor19780726 [428]

Answer:

Homophones are words that sound the same but are spelled differently and have different meanings, some examples are...

Explanation:

1. Recede, Reseed

2. Need, Knead

3. No, Know

4. Hey, Hay

5. Bale, Bail

6. Grate, Great

7. Brake, Break

8. Flour, Flower

9. Knot, Not

20. Here, Hear
